Over the last 24 hours I have received a huge number of lovely and heartfelt messages from people who have expressed their dismay at my resignation, urging me to reconsider.
After 11 months of working as a volunteer to build a political party from scratch, with barely a single day off, my tweet was a decision born of exhaustion.
I only came into politics out of a sense of duty, to serve the country I love. The country that had been so kind to my parents and presented me with immense opportunity.
Out of a sense of duty to do whatever I could to reverse decades of decline and make this a country one in which we could be excited for our children to grow up.
I came into politics out of belief that Nigel Farage was the man to deliver that.
Having read the messages, I believe in these things more than ever.
I know the mission is too important and I cannot let people down.
So, I will be continuing my work with Reform, my commitment redoubled.
Reform has come a long way since I was appointed Chairman, and has moved from ‘startup’ to ‘scaleup’.
Given this, and that we have now won power at a local level, I will focus on a new role. I will be running the UK DOGE team to fight for taxpayers, as well as working on party policy and representing it in the media.
I will continue to give all my time to the most important project of my life, getting a Reform government elected with Nigel as Prime Minister. 🇬🇧
